Electromagnetic clutch assembly having enhanced torque throughput

1. An electromagnetic clutch assembly comprising, in combination,an input member and a coaxially disposed output member, a first circular member having a plurality of camming surfaces, a second circular member adjacent said first circular member having a like plurality of camming surfaces and splined to said output member for rotation therewith, a like plurality of load transferring balls disposed on said camming surfaces, a circular friction member operably disposed between said first circular member and said input member, a first clutch pack having a first plurality of first clutch plates splined to said first circular member and a second, interleaved plurality of first clutch plates splined to said input member, an electromagnetic coil for engaging said first clutch pack, and a second clutch pack having a first plurality of second clutch plates splined to said input member and a second, interleaved plurality of second clutch plates splined to said output member.
